BRABUS Marine continues to redefine luxury day boating with its latest design evolution, the BRABUS Shadow 900 Stealth Green Signature Edition. The high-performance luxury adventure tender will be unveiled to the world as a Sun-Top model at stand B-59 (hall 4) during Boot Düsseldorf, 21-29 January 2023. The Sun-Top model is representing the full Signature Edition, which furthermore consists of a fully enclosed XC Cross-Cabin and open Spyder model. A striking embodiment of uncompromising marine high-performance and modern outdoor lifestyle, this unmistakable Signature Edition is the newest addition to the BRABUS Shadow 900 range. With its charismatic looks and high-class functionality, it’s a perfect fit for those who are ready to push the boundaries – BRABUS style and make an undeniable statement of design, one of a kind luxury and individuality. At first glance, the boat impresses with an evocative BRABUS 1-Second-Wow design scheme, combining a distinctive paintjob in BRABUS “Stealth Green” with matching Signature Style graphics, a wide range of high-grade carbon elements, contrasting matte black detail work, Masterpiece and Sign of Excellence badges as well as the BRABUS “Sunrise” upholstery color. The confident contrasts in color and material exudes a highly luxurious, contemporary outdoor aesthetic – in this combination a most unique design transfer that guarantees owners will stand out from a crowd, anywhere. The unveiling of the Stealth Green Signature Edition is synchronized with the launch of the PANERAI SUBMERSIBLE S BRABUS VERDE MILITARE EDITION. A brand new, highly-exclusive dive watch and the latest product of the collaboration between expert Italian watchmaker Panerai and BRABUS and was conceptualized to perfectly match the day boat in its design and functionality. Built for blistering acceleration, the Stealth Green Signature Edition is powered by dual Mercury Marine 450R 4.6-liter V8 Four Stroke racing engines, producing a combined output of 900 hp. This means, the day boat can reach 60+ knots like it’s a walk in the park. Aside from its exhilarating speeds, the edition features another key element inspired by the BRABUS portfolio of Masterpiece supercars: The helm area. Everything on the boat’s clean and ergonomic dashboard is within reach. But that’s not all. Fingertip controls, backlit switches, touchscreen technology as well as the multifunctional steering wheel make this one of the most futuristic consoles and allows Shadow 900 drivers to take total control of their on-water experiences.

Life Proof Boats constructs all of our vessels within the Bremerton Industrial Park, located in Washington State. We have expanded within three facilities and have approximately 40,000 square feet of total manufacturing. We utilize a dedicated facility for welding, a separate dedicated facility for all of our collar manufacturing & upholstery, and two facilities dedicated for system integrations. Because our boats are used in the toughest of environments, they are built stronger. That is why we exclusively use 5086 H116 Grade Aluminum plate in all of our boats. A lot of other builders choose to use 5052 alloy aluminum because it can cost up to 20% less. But 5086 H116 is much stronger in a welded condition and more durable. Even our custom hull strake extrusions are made from 5086 alloy aluminum. All of the parts used to build Life Proof Boats are cut on a CNC router machine. We choose CNC router cut parts over water jet or plasma cut parts because a router provides a more pure surface on the cut edge. Water or plasma machines often leave a very porous edge surface, which can lead to microvoids in the welding process. All of our parts are also cut on a CNC router machine because of the higher quality surface edge provides. Water or plasma machines often leave a very porous edge surface, which can lead to micro voids in the welding process. With many of our competitors looking to build at the lowest cost, it often means they sacrifice quality in the materials they choose to use. We look at it differently. If quality is a pillar of your brand, then people will choose it for its known quality. Our quality is our difference and will always be a core to who we are. We have spent countless hours looking at materials and components to ensure our boats are built using the best industry available parts. Before starting a new design we work through principles in naval architecture to ensure all our vessels have the correct structural design, proper LCG & VCG & TCG locations, and proper waterline location. We engineer all of the boat's structural pieces to "egg crate" or interconnect. That is to ensure a perfect fit and add rigidity to the platforms. Every piece of aluminum in the boat is engineering to be used in a specific location for a specific function. Each part is purpose built. Our employees are the best and brightest in the industry. We have assembled a team of people who are highly skilled and highly educated in what it takes to build a high quality product that will last for generations. Our boats are built tougher because they are driven tougher. We choose to build our boats on a hull jig because it allows us to keep the hull plates extremely straight and true. The hull is the foundation that influences how the boat handles, drives, feels, and performs. A true hull shape is critical. Running longitudinally down the center of the boat, you will find two full height frames. These frames create one of the strongest known beam designs known to structural engineering; an I-Beam. This I-Beam design disperses the stresses from heavy slamming loads.

Neocean is reinventing mobility on the water. Thanks to the Overboat, a compact, electric, automatic and ecological catamaran, flight is within everyone's reach. The incomparable nautical qualities of the Overboat make it suitable for a very wide audience: for professionals who want a boat that is very maneuverable, quiet and without waves; for individuals wishing to go out on the water with the unique impression of flying silently above the water. Neocean combines state-of-the-art technologies with the strictest respect for environmental impact. Neocean designs, manufactures and distributes electric boats and technological equipment. The French start-up is building the Overboat in France to optimize quality, reliability and maintainability for professionals and large yachts. The Overboat is the dream of oceanographer Vincent Dufour who led a team of experts over the past 3 years after first envisioning the water craft in 2012 when hydrofoiling sailboats took hold of his principal motivation: creating a new way of boating without polluting or disturbing marine life. The Overboat is a clean and quiet personal water craft. It is equipped with the latest technologies of automated hydrofoils and electric propulsion. With the Overboat we can all fly over the water. The Overboat is stabilized by 4 electronically controlled foils. Flying effortlessly becomes possible thanks to the unique combination of 3 advanced technologies. It is an ecological delight, with a 60% reduction in energy requirement: only the hydrofoils and legs are in the water once the boat has taken off. An electric motor with direct drive which, at equal power, consumes 3 times less energy than a heat engine. A lighter platform, the floats simply having a role of buoyancy when stationary and for take-off. An electric foil boat consumes only 20% of the energy consumed by the same outboard motorboat… and with zero noise and zero polluting emissions in the water. The second-generation foils lift the boat completely out of the water with better profiled “vertical” legs that take up less space under the boat. These are real underwater wings capable, with speed, of lifting the machine to which they are attached. In the opinion of all experts, the so-called inverted T profile is by far the most efficient for a mechanically propelled boat The horizontal plane is the best way to support a machine (like the wings of planes). The vertical foil leg reduces drag and limits the ventilation phenomena (turbulence on the surface), which draws air down the leg and can create a drop in the foil (loss of lift). Their patented automatic regulation technology is the most efficient with inverted T foils. This limits the forces involved. In the field of robotics and mechatronics, it is important to limit the efforts to be made, because this reduces the size of the actuators and increases their reliability. We have created an automatic system that is light, robust and efficient. The University of Montpellier, ranked first French university in innovation, has world-renowned laboratories in several fields including marine robotics, the environment alongside technological platforms in robotics, electronics and mechanics. Models can also be tested in a 25 m covered test pool. Numerous French government agencies (CDC, CNRS, etc.) were also on board and the business accelerator AXLR Satt selected our innovative project. The design of the Overboat is brought to life with the insight and support of naval architects. Construction is carried out by the SCC yard in Balaruc with foil and composite specialists. Many partners and subcontractors are mobilized around this innovative project (design offices, platforms). The Overboat 100 Classic is a small,100% electric catamaran, license-free, light and easy to handle. It can be used from 14 years old thanks to its intuitive control and its 7-inch digital screen. It allows you to navigate in waters at regulated speed or in marine protected areas without disturbing underwater fauna. A very economical boat to use and competitive to buy. Neocean received the Grand Prize for Innovation at the 40th Inn'Ovations de la Région Occitanie competition and the prize for intelligent and sustainable mobility.

ZeroJet’s story begins in 2014 when our co-founders - entrepreneurs and outdoors-enthusiasts Bex and Neil - moved to Perth and opened the world’s first Jetsurf Experience Centre. Through buying, selling and renting out these Czech-made boards, they simultaneously realised a) how big the market was, and b) the negative impact these petrol-powered, two-stroke motorised surfboards were having on the environment. During this time, Bex made a video which went viral online, and it was further proof that there was an enthusiastic market waiting to be served. But Bex and Neil decided to serve up something a bit greener; something to counteract the jetboards’ carbon footprint. So in 2015 they moved back to New Zealand and founded Voltaic Jetboards. After assembling a team of four engineers - all ex-Buckley Systems; a New Zealand success story making electromagnets for particle accelerators - the crew started work on a more environmentally-friendly alternative, and they spent the next two years developing high-performance electric jetboards. Fast-forward to 2018, the team had carried out significant Research & Development on a bespoke jet pump design paired with electric motor and custom hull design using their hydrodynamic expertise. In other words, they produced a finalised design and a high-performing prototype: the world’s fastest electric jetboard, hitting speeds of 70 km/hr. With such positive feedback about the impressive performance their electric jetboard was capable of, it was the interest of boat builders that ultimately influenced the team to pivot their business and focus purely on electric jet systems for boats. Although the opportunity was a daunting one, it was also a fantastic chance to make a much greater impact in the world. During this year, the first prototype electric jet tender was designed and built - though it actually packed a little too much punch! Despite the relative international chaos of 2020, it was a year of exponential growth for Bex, Neil and their team. After rebranding to ZeroJet and raising seed capital from investors, the team grew to 10 and managed to hit a number of key milestones, including: - completed a 3 month Startmate accelerator program - built the world’s lightest electric jet tender - developed a highly efficient jetpod system designed for 3 m to 4 m boats - formed an ongoing partnership with Offshore Cruising Tenders - launched publicly and started making sales to a very interested marine industry. Alongside the material and technical development journey of ZeroJet, some powerful comparisons have been made to the automotive industry, to gauge the impact of traditional petrol-powered outboard motors on the marine environment. In short, taking one 20hp four-stroke outboard off the water is the equivalent of taking 150 cars off the road - and that’s something we’re striving to have a hand in. Our plans include partnering with more boat builders, expanding internationally, and developing systems for larger 5 m and 6 m tenders, all working towards our ultimate audacious goal of eliminating the need for combustion engines on small watercraft.

The company was founded by two leading figures of the nautical world: Sergio Maggi, designer and inventor of the ISS (Integrated Structural System), a revolutionary manufacturing concept, and Marcello Bé, who has a thorough knowledge of fiberglass and modern procedures of yacht construction. Absolute's first appearance on the market is dated 2002 and is based in Podenzano, Piacenza (Italy) From there on, Absolute have increased its importance in the worldwide market of motor yachts by constantly devoting its energies to research on technologies and innovation. Absolute can count on a worldwide sales network and a positive trend that have already brought it to be among the best worldwide yachts manufacturers. Absolute is independent both financially and in management. The different phases of studying, planning, and production are developed internally thanks to our unique combination of experienced professionals in the yachting industry. Absolute is renowned internationally thanks to our network of dealers working hand-in-hand with the company and being committed to its principles. Absolute is the symbol for experience, innovation, and practicality with yachts appreciated all around the world. Today, the company has solidified its place inside the yachting industry globally by winning several international awards for the design and architectural characteristics of our models. Absolute Spa designs and builds luxury yachts from 47 up to 73 feet in the Navetta, Flybridge and Coupé ranges.

Pershing Yacht has been designing, producing and marketing luxury “open” motor yachts for over 30 years, and now boasts a firmly established position as one of the leading names in the “Made in Italy” fibreglass open yacht sector. The Pershing range stands out for its superior performance, constantly researched style, top quality materials and painstakingly designed interiors that offer ultimate comfort. Advanced construction methods, powerful engines reaching 7400 MHP and the use of surface propellers, hydrojets and gas turbines all combine to give Pershing yachts a distinctively sporting trim and peak speeds of up to 52 knots. Passion, creativity and continuous research of innovation have always been the primary values of the Pershing philosophy, qualities that have been growing up with the brand since the beginning. The story of Pershing is a fascinating one, originated by the lucky intuition of three friends with a profound passion for boating. Tilli Antonelli, Fausto Filippetti and Giuliano Onori set out on this exciting adventure in 1981 combining fun with passion and initiative. The same year the Cantieri Navali dell’Adriatico was founded and the first boat was launched. Four years later, in 1985, after the meeting with Yacht Designer, Fulvio De Simoni, the Pershing idea came into being. Thus, the first Pershing 45’ was designed, an open yacht, which became a huge success, thanks to its new standards of comfort and privacy that had hitherto been the exclusive domain of classic motoryachts. The early 1990s marked a turning point for the shipyard, as it began an inspired policy of internationalization towards Mediterranean countries, the United States and the Far East. In 1998, the company joined the Ferretti Group, a leading enterprise in the luxury yacht sector, and this wonderful adventure continues to this day with new premises and with the same enthusiasm with which it started out. Pershing yachts are produced in the Mondolfo yard (located right in front of the original yard), a futuristic site of 55,000 square metres - of which more than 38,400 in the open air - designed by the architect Sandro Sartini. Much more than a simple production centre: this is a striking scenario that couples beauty, technological functionality and dream, a space designed in every detail to cater for steady development of production and the product range enlargement, also in terms of size of yachts. The new production site features a large and innovative painting booth of 440 sq m, where boats are dry painted. The test basin (33 m lenght, 7.5 m wide and 2.3 m deep) is used for all hydraulic tests (engines, exhausts, bilges and generators) and for waterproofing tests of yachts. The travel lift, with a carrying capacity of 130 tons, completes activities with ship haulage and launching in the test basin. Besenzoni S.p.A. offers an incomparable range of products: external and re-entering gangways, deck or garage cranes to hoist tenders and water toys, automatic roof systems, pilot seats, bathing - boarding and multifunctional ladders, patio and pantograph doors, windows with electric movement, balconies and garage doors opening solutions, automations beach area and anything else that may be entrusted to an accessory. 7 collections gather today over 170 products. Made with the usual attention to detail and enriched by the most innovative and avant-garde technological and design solutions, they constitute the widest range available on the market. From the artisan enterprise of the beginning to the industrial and structured reality of today, the innate ability to create innovation in the nautical sector characterizes the whole history of Besenzoni: born thanks to the foresight of its founder, Giovanni Besenzoni, the Bergamo-based company has made technological research the engine for its constant evolution. This gives rise to great innovations in the years 70/80 for the boating industry as the stern platform with ladder and the very first hydraulic gangways with hydraulic functioning moved easily by remote control. Essentially, it was also the contribution of Giorgio Besenzoni, son of Giovanni, who has steered the company into the third millennium with innovative and creative spirit. As the leading provider of watercraft history reports, Boat History Report® helps our customers make better used watercraft purchase decisions by putting all available information at your fingertips. This type of information helps consumers guard themselves against buying a stolen boat or one with hidden damage which could negatively impact safety on the water. We started in 2005 as a small dot-com, but through our partnerships and dedication to the marine industry and used boat business, we have grown to help customers all across the world. Our customers include used boat buyers, sellers, dealers/brokers, marine surveyors, law enforcement, and finance and insurance companies. We are the most trusted resource for boat history information and a great place to start (or finish!) when looking to purchase or sell a used boat. In 2005, Founder and CEO Grant Brooks was researching his next used boat and noticed that it was very difficult, and sometimes impossible, to find the complete history of used boats on the market. “There were some resources out there, but nothing was conclusive and everything was scattered. The safety of my friends and family was crucial and knowing if a boat I was going to buy had something that could negatively affect their well-being created fear and uncertainty with my purchase. The data was out there... it just needed to be gathered from many public and private sources and consolidated to one place, so boat buyers like you and I could easily search it.” Since starting the company, Boat History Report® continually hears success stories from people just like us who were able to make more informed decisions and safer choices when purchasing used boats.
